What is the geology of the area surrounding the property?

The land is underlain by Silurian‑age rocks, primarily Deakin Volcanics purple rhyodacite. In the south‑west corner you’ll also find grey tuff from the Laidlaw Volcanics and the Deakin Fault runs along the north‑east edge of the suburb.

What is the origin of the street name ‘Lance Hill Avenue’?

Lance Hill Avenue is named after Lance Hill, the inventor who created the Hills hoist, a height‑adjustable rotary clothes line, back in 1945. The naming follows Dunlop’s tradition of honoring Australian inventors.
